Registered Nurse Behavioral Health Travel
About the role
Provide care to behavioral health patients per facility policies.
Conduct bio-psychosocial assessments and develop nursing plans of care aligned with the master treatment plan.
Participate in conferences to plan and revise age-specific and problem-specific goals and interventions.
Lead or co-lead group therapy sessions.
Monitor patient responses and collaborate with the treatment team to adjust nursing plans and objectives as needed.

Requirements
- Licensure / Certification / Registration: Required Credential(s) BLS Provider obtained within 1 Month (30 days) of hire date or job transfer date. American Heart Association or American Red Cross accepted.
- Registered Nurse obtained prior to hire date or job transfer date.
- Education: Diploma from an accredited school/college of nursing OR Required professional licensure at time of hire.
Preferences
- 1+ year of recent experience in Behavioral Health.
